Progress is being made towards a new fire hall in Lucknow.
Huron-Kinloss Council has passed the deeming by-law required for where the new fire hall will be located on Campbell Street.
Mayor Mitch Twolan says the drawings of the new facility and the building ‘envelope’ itself are complete, and the next step is for the project to go to tender.
As for concerns about water drainage on the site, Twolan says those will also be addressed during the tendering process.
He says construction will start once a tender is accepted.
In June, Ashfield-Colborne Wawanosh received 700 thousand dollars in Infrastructure Stimulus funding for the new fire hall.
Huron-Kinloss and Ashfield-Colborne-Wawanosh share ownership and operation of the Lucknow and District Fire Department.
